Ivermectin's FDA-approved uses — strongyloidiasis and onchocerciasis (river blindness) — reflect its core competency: killing parasites. That part isn't in dispute. What's contested is how common parasitic infection actually is in places like the US, and how much of it goes undiagnosed.

The numbers are noteworthy.

4M Soil-transmitted helminth infections (US)
1.2M Giardiasis cases (US)
1.3–2.8M Serologic evidence of Toxocara exposure (US)

Estimates cited in the parasitology literature also point to smaller but real populations affected by Chagas disease and cysticercosis. A 2023 review in Clinical Microbiology Reviews argues these infections are underrated as a domestic public health issue, not just a "travel medicine" concern. The CDC has also flagged neglected parasitic infections as an area where diagnostic awareness lags the actual burden.

At the same time, many public health researchers push back on the notion that "most" Americans are walking around with an undiagnosed parasite load driving their fatigue, brain fog, or chronic symptoms. In their opinion, the data don't support that version.

They believe parasitic infection in the US is real, likely underdiagnosed in specific populations (immunocompromised patients, certain immigrant communities, people with specific exposures), and probably not the hidden epidemic some claim.

Both things can be true at once, and reasonable people land in different places on how much weight to give each side.

The Cancer Question: Real Research, Very Early Stage

This is the part getting more attention lately, and it's worth being precise about what's actually been shown versus what's being implied.

The mechanistic case starts with a 2014 study in EMBO Molecular Medicine by Melotti et al., which found that ivermectin inhibits the WNT-TCF signaling pathway — a pathway implicated in a wide range of cancers — and induced apoptosis in several human cancer cell lines in vitro, with selective effects in mouse xenograft models.

A 2018 review in the American Journal of Cancer Research ("The multitargeted drug ivermectin: from an antiparasitic agent to a repositioned cancer drug") catalogs a broader set of mechanisms proposed across the literature: induction of reactive oxygen species and mitochondrial dysfunction, modulation of the Akt/mTOR pathway, and effects on cancer stem cell populations, studied across glioma, colorectal, bladder, cervical, breast, and other cell lines. More recent papers, including a 2025 piece on glioblastoma repurposing and one on endocrine-resistant breast cancer via Wnt signaling, keep extending the list of cancer types studied in vitro.

Here's where it's important to slow down. As of mid-2026, a PubMed search across ivermectin-and-cancer literature turns up roughly 50 preclinical (lab and animal) studies and effectively no completed human clinical trials demonstrating a therapeutic benefit. There's exactly one active human trial that's gotten notice — a Phase I/II study at Cedars-Sinai combining ivermectin with checkpoint inhibitors (Balstilimab or Pembrolizumab) in metastatic triple-negative breast cancer — and it hasn't reported results.

Multiple recent review articles, including a 2025 piece in Current Oncology Reports and separate commentary flagged by the National Cancer Institute's own researchers, raise a specific technical concern: the concentrations of ivermectin needed to kill cancer cells in a petri dish are often at or above what's achievable in human blood plasma at safe doses. That gap — lab concentration versus achievable human dose — is the central unresolved question in this entire body of research, and it's the reason "kills cancer cells in vitro" and "treats cancer in people" are not the same claim.

The mechanistic story is genuinely interesting, multiple independent labs have published on it, and it's attracted enough legitimate scientific interest to generate an NCI look and at least one real oncology trial. It's also, right now, unproven in humans, with a known dosing problem that hasn't been solved. Both facts are true simultaneously, and where that leaves things depends on how much weight you put on early mechanistic signal versus the absence of clinical proof.
